The Parish Council is doing its best to remove ragwort across our local area because when it goes to seed, this harmful weed spreads vigorously. To help with this, the Parish Council is calling on the local community to remove any ragwort that they may find in their gardens. 

Ragwort is an injurious weed under the Weeds Act 1959 and is harmful and poisonous to animals and can damage crops if it spreads. The Weeds Act 1959 requires landowners to remove harmful weeds growing on their land to stop it spreading on to other land; particularly land used as agricultural land.
The best way to remove ragwort is by pulling or digging it out, and it is advisable to use gloves when doing so.
